First you should boot into safe mode:
1) Repeatedly strike the f8 key as the computer is starting
2) Select "Safe Mode with Networking"
-Head to: http://www.trendmicro.com/spyware-scan/
(in Internet Explorer)
-Follow those instructions to install it and give it a run!
-After it finishes select "show results"
-Then select "clean threats"
I'd also recommend downloading spybot and adaware. Make sure you update them prior to running a scan!
Let us know Trend Micro's results! Hopefully that helps you out!

Please then reboot your computer in Safe Mode by doing the
following :
- Restart your computer
- After hearing your computer beep once during startup, but before the
Windows icon appears, tap the F8 key continually; - Instead of Windows loading as normal, a menu with options should appear;
- Select the first option, to run Windows in Safe Mode, then press "Enter".
- Choose your usual account.
- In Safe Mode, right click the SDFix.zip folder and choose Extract
All, - Open the extracted folder and double click RunThis.bat to
start the script. - Type Y to begin the script.
- It will remove the Trojan Services then make some repairs to the
registry and prompt you to press any key to Reboot. - Press any Key and it will restart the PC.
- Your system will take longer that normal to restart as the fixtool
will be running and removing files. - When the desktop loads the Fixtool will complete the removal and
display Finished, then press any key to end the script and load
your desktop icons. - Finally open the SDFix folder on your desktop and copy and paste the
contents of the results file Report.txt back onto the forum with
a new HijackThis log
